Preferred term

international media education  

Definition

  • Media education is a term used to refer to the process involved in learning how to critically analyze and create media messages. The term originated in England, where it is generally synonymous with media literacy. [Source: Encyclopedia of Children, Adolescents, and the Media; Media Education, International]
